MANILA, Philippines — Manila Mayor Sheila 'Honey' Lacuna-Pangan, Speaker Martin Romualdez, and the city's 5th District Rep. Irwin Tieng led the groundbreaking ceremony on Tuesday for the new cancer center at Ospital ng Maynila, which will offer free medical assistance to residents battling cancer.

The center will be a five-story building with a 38-bed capacity and cutting-edge medical technology, including a Linear Accelerator, a SPECT Gamma Camera with a Treadmill Machine, and a CT Scan.Tieng commended Lacuna's generosity in allocating 2,000 square meters for the center.It will be situated within the Ospital ng Maynila compound and will be named in honor of the late Governor Benjamin 'Kokoy' Romualdez, the father of Speaker Romualdez.
